打数字验证码通常用于验证用户输入的数字信息是否正确,可以通过以下步骤来实现。
1、生成验证码:使用随机数生成器生成一组随机数字,这组数字将作为验证码,可以根据需要设置验证码的长度,例如4位、6位等。
2、显示验证码:将生成的验证码显示在页面上,可以通过图片、文本等形式展示,如果使用图片展示,可以在图片上添加干扰线条、背景色等,以增加验证码的安全性。
3、用户输入验证码:要求用户输入页面上显示的验证码,以验证用户是否正确地识别了验证码。

4、验证用户输入:将用户输入的验证码与生成的验证码进行比对,如果一致则验证通过,否则验证失败。
在实现打数字验证码时,需要注意以下几点:
1、验证码的长度应该适中,不宜过长或过短,以便于用户识别和输入。
2、验证码应该具有一定的随机性,以避免被恶意攻击者猜测或破解。

3、可以考虑添加其他验证方式,如字母、字符等,以提高验证码的安全性。
4、在处理用户输入时,应该注意防止输入污染和注入攻击等安全问题。
是一种简单的实现打数字验证码的方法,具体实现方式可以根据实际需求进行调整和优化。




